Output 7703765dd87f9194fd4fe225ca54aba337ddb153f8a047cfe38c3b898cf901a0:6

value
185138482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a854e1652a96747ee27c58b6fb5472ef8e4e5134 OP_EQUAL
address
3H358NKGiuuftkHb6gAKgZE5zfHKKvJMq6
transaction
7703765dd87f9194fd4fe225ca54aba337ddb153f8a047cfe38c3b898cf901a0
confirmations
177674
spent
true